if the minimum wage is set above the equilibrium wage, a supply and demand diagram of the low-skilled labor market will show unemployment as

Answers

If the minimum wage is set above the equilibrium wage, a supply and demand diagram of the low-skilled labor market will show unemployment as an increase in the quantity of labor supplied that exceeds the quantity demanded.

The law of supply and demand determines the price and the quantity of the goods and services that are being bought and sold. The supply and demand diagram for the low-skilled labor market is shown in the figure below, with the wage rate (w) on the vertical axis and the quantity of labor (L) on the horizontal axis.

The equilibrium wage rate (we) is determined at the intersection of the demand and supply curves. At this point, the quantity of labor supplied is equal to the quantity of labor demanded.

If the minimum wage is set above the equilibrium wage, the result will be a decrease in the quantity of labor demanded, an increase in the quantity of labor supplied that exceeds the quantity demanded, and unemployment.

In other words, firms will demand less labor at higher wage rates, while workers will be willing to supply more labor at higher wage rates. When the minimum wage is set above the equilibrium wage, firms will be willing to hire fewer workers than the number of workers willing to work at that wage rate.

As a result, there will be a surplus of workers, which is unemployment in the labor market.

What is the yield to maturity on an 18-year, zero coupon bond selling for 40% of par value? Assume annual compounding.

Select one:

a. 6.92%

b. 5.22%

c. 6.37%

d. 30.00%

e. 4.86%

Answers

The yield to maturity (YTM) on an 18-year, zero coupon bond selling for 40% of its par value is 6.92%.

Yield to maturity (YTM) is the total return anticipated on a bond if it is held until its maturity date. It represents the average annual rate of return that an investor can expect to earn by investing in a bond until it matures, assuming all coupon payments are reinvested at the same YTM.

Yield to maturity takes into account the bond's purchase price, its face value (par value), the coupon rate, the number of years to maturity, and the reinvestment of coupon payments. It reflects the present value of all future cash flows (coupon payments and the final principal payment) discounted at the YTM rate.

To calculate the yield to maturity (YTM) of a zero coupon bond, we need to use the formula:

YTM = (Face Value / Current Price) ^ (1 / Number of Years) - 1

In this case, the bond has a maturity of 18 years and is selling for 40% of its par value. This means the current price is 40% of the face value.

Let's calculate the yield to maturity:

YTM = (100% / 40%) ^ (1 / 18) - 1

YTM = 2.5 ^ 0.05555 - 1

YTM = 1.0692 - 1

YTM = 0.0692

Converting the decimal to a percentage, we get:

YTM = 6.92%

The yield to maturity (YTM) on an 18-year, zero coupon bond selling for 40% of its par value is 6.92%. Therefore, the correct answer is (a) 6.92%.

Consider the reaction. Upper H subscript 2 upper o (g) plus upper C l subscript 2 upper O (g) double-headed arrow 2 upper H upper C l upper O (g). At equilibrium, the concentrations of the different species are as follows. [H2O] = 0. 077 M [Cl2O] = 0. 077 M [HClO] = 0. 023 M What is the equilibrium constant for the reaction at this temperature? 0. 089 0. 26 3. 9 11.

Answers

The equilibrium constant for the reaction at this temperature is approximately 0.089.

What is the equilibrium constant for the given reaction at the specified temperature, where [H2O] = 0.077 M, [Cl2O] = 0.077 M, and [HClO] = 0.023 M?

To determine the equilibrium constant for the given reaction, we can use the concentrations of the species at equilibrium. The equilibrium constant, denoted as Kc, is defined as the ratio of the product concentrations to the reactant concentrations, with each concentration raised to the power of its stoichiometric coefficient.

For the reaction: H₂O(g) + Cl₂O(g) ⇌ 2HClO(g)

The concentrations at equilibrium are:

[H₂O] = 0.077 M

[Cl₂O] = 0.077 M

[HClO] = 0.023 M

Using these values, we can calculate the equilibrium constant:

Kc = ([HClO]²) / ([H₂O] × [Cl₂O])

Substituting the given concentrations:

Kc = (0.023 M)² / (0.077 M × 0.077 M)

Kc = 0.000529 / 0.005929

Kc = 0.089

Therefore, the equilibrium constant for the reaction at this temperature is approximately 0.089.

Elaborate the importance of motivation for sale Force and discuss in brief the important tools of Motivation​

Answers

The importance of motivation for the sales force is crucial, as it directly impacts their performance, job satisfaction, and commitment to achieving company goals. Motivation encourages salespeople to put in their best effort, resulting in increased sales and improved customer relationships.

Important tools of motivation for the sales force include:

1. Financial incentives: Offering competitive salaries, bonuses, and commission structures to reward sales performance and align individual goals with organizational objectives.

2. Non-financial incentives: Providing recognition, praise, and opportunities for career growth to foster a sense of accomplishment and belonging within the sales team.

3. Training and development: Ensuring salespeople have access to the necessary resources, coaching, and ongoing support to develop their skills, confidence, and expertise in their roles.

4. Goal setting and performance management: Establishing clear, achievable targets and regularly reviewing progress helps to create a sense of direction and purpose for the sales force.

5. Positive work environment: Encouraging teamwork, open communication, and a supportive culture can significantly enhance motivation levels and overall job satisfaction.

By utilizing these motivational tools, companies can effectively engage and energize their sales force, leading to higher performance, increased sales, and long-term success.

assume that a nation's real gross domestic product (gdp) grows at a higher rate than its population over a given period of time. it can be concluded that

Answers

If a nation's real Gross Domestic Product (GDP) grows at a higher rate than its population over a given period of time, it can be concluded that the nation is experiencing economic growth in per capita terms.

This means that, on average, each individual in the country is experiencing an increase in their share of the total economic output. The higher rate of GDP growth compared to population growth suggests that the nation's economy is becoming more productive and efficient. It indicates that the country is generating more goods and services relative to the size of its population, resulting in an improvement in living standards. This growth can be attributed to various factors such as technological advancements, increased investment, improvements in productivity, and favourable economic policies.

Thomas Edison is credited with the invention of direct current. Nicholas Tesla is given credit for inventing alternating current. Both men lived at the same time, and both invented light bulbs based on their kind of current at roughly the same time. For this discussion board, you need to do a little research on each of these inventors, and then decide which one made the more significant contribution to society based on their inventions. In other words, has the invention of direct current or alternating current had a larger and/or more lasting impact on society? In your post, tell us which inventor you vote for and your reasons why

Answers

When comparing the contributions of Thomas Edison and Nikola Tesla to society, it is important to consider the impact of their respective inventions of direct current (DC) and alternating current (AC) systems.

While both inventors made significant contributions to the field of electrical power, I believe that Nikola Tesla's invention of alternating current has had a larger and more lasting impact on society.

Firstly, AC power transmission revolutionized the distribution of electricity. Tesla's development of AC systems allowed for the efficient transmission of electricity over long distances, making it possible to power cities and towns from centralized power stations. This greatly expanded access to electricity, leading to the widespread ad of electrical appliances, lighting, and industrial machinery. AC power transmission remains the foundation of our modern electrical grid, enabling the distribution of electricity to homes, business , and industries worldwide.

Secondly, AC power is more versatile and adaptable compared to DC power. AC systems allow for voltage regulation through transformers, enabling power to be easily stepped up or down for efficient transmission or use at different voltage levels. This flexibility in voltage conversion has played a crucial role in the development of various electrical technologies, such as electric motors, generators, and appliances. AC power's ability to be converted and transformed efficiently has contributed to its widespread ad in multiple industries, including manufacturing, transportation, and telecommunications.

Additionally, AC power's ability to support polyphase systems has been instrumental in powering industrial machinery and facilitating the growth of modern industries. The three-phase AC power system, in particular, has become the standard for industrial power distribution due to its efficiency and ability to drive powerful motors.

Furthermore, Tesla's inventions and contributions extended beyond AC power. He made significant advancements in wireless communication, X-ray technology, and induction motors, among other inventions. His work laid the foundation for future technologies and influenced many scientific and engineering developments.

In conclusion, while Thomas Edison's invention of direct current had its merits and played a role in early electrical advancements, Nikola Tesla's invention of alternating current and its subsequent impact on power transmission, versatility, and industrial development have had a larger and more lasting impact on society. The widespread ad of AC power systems and their contributions to modern electrical infrastructure make Tesla's contributions vital to our modern way of life.
